Newport Plum Trees (Prunus cerasifera 'Newport') are small to medium-sized deciduous trees that typically grow up to 20 feet tall. They have an attractive, rounded shape with a spreading canopy and bark that ranges from dark gray to reddish-brown. In the spring, Newport Plum Trees produce an abundance of fragrant, white flowers that cover the tree's branches and provide a striking display. The flowers are followed by small plums that ripen in the summer, perfect for pollinators and wildlife. Though the Newport Plum produces fruit, it is best to leave the fruit for wildlife to enjoy as it is more of an ornamental tree rather than a fruit tree.
